Canada’s Prime Minister Mark Carney makes history as the first PM in 26 years to visit Saudi Arabia, forging a new chapter in ties with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man. They inked a defense and trade coordination pact, signaling a pragmatic pivot away from past confrontations — including the 2018 fallout over jailed activists that led to expulsions and threats. Carney argues that moral lectures won’t move the needle, but behind-the-scenes diplomacy can. While he sidestepped public human rights critiques during his Saudi talks, Foreign Affairs Minister Anita Anand continues raising concerns elsewhere — notably with Turkey and Saudi Arabia’s foreign minister. This thaw, building since 2023, reflects Canada’s recalibrated strategy: engagement over isolation, cooperation over condemnation.
